Navigating the World of Online Casino Bonuses
Online casino bonuses are a common tactic used to attract new players and retain existing ones. They come in various forms, each with its own set of terms and conditions. Understanding these terms is crucial to avoid disappointment and maximize the benefits of the offer. Welcome bonuses are typically the most generous, often matching a player's initial deposit with a percentage bonus. Deposit matches require players to deposit funds into their account, with the casino then awarding a corresponding bonus amount. Free spins are another popular type of bonus, allowing players to spin the reels of a specific slot machine without risking their own money. No-deposit bonuses are particularly attractive, as they award players with a small amount of bonus money simply for signing up, without requiring a deposit. However, these bonuses often come with stricter wagering requirements.
Wagering requirements, also known as playthrough requirements, define the amount of money a player must bet before they can withdraw any winnings earned from a bonus. For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means that a player must wager 30 times the bonus amount before they can cash out. It's important to carefully read the terms and conditions of any bonus offer to understand the wagering requirements, as well as any restrictions on eligible games or maximum bet sizes. Additionally, some bonuses may have time limits, requiring players to meet the wagering requirements within a specific timeframe. Ensuring Fair Play and Responsible Gaming
Fair play is a cornerstone of a reputable online casino. Casinos employ Random Number Generators (RNGs) to ensure that the outcome of each game is truly random and unbiased. These RNGs are regularly audited by independent testing agencies to verify their fairness and integrity. Reputable casinos will prominently display the results of these audits on their website, providing transparency and reassurance to players. Licensing is another crucial aspect of fair play. Online casinos are typically licensed by regulatory bodies in specific jurisdictions, who oversee their operations and ensure compliance with industry standards. A valid license indicates that the casino has met certain requirements regarding security, fairness, and responsible gaming.

Recognizing the Signs of Problem Gambling
Identifying problem gambling is crucial for seeking timely help. Some common signs include gambling more than you can afford to lose, chasing losses, lying to family and friends about your gambling habits, neglecting responsibilities, and experiencing feelings of guilt or shame. If you find yourself preoccupied with gambling, or if it's negatively impacting your life, it's important to seek help. There are numerous organizations dedicated to providing support for problem gambling, including the National Council on Problem Gambling and Gamblers Anonymous. These organizations offer a variety of resources, including counseling, support groups, and educational materials.
